Rodger Self

ANNISTON, Mo. -- Rodger Charles Self, 61, of Anniston died Monday, Jan. 12, 2009, at John Cochran VA Medical Center in St. Louis.

He was born Aug. 21, 1947, in the Deventer community of Mississippi County, Mo., son of Charles and Nadine Armer Self Jr.

Having lived in Mississippi County his entire life, he had been employed for a number of years at Thomason Shell Station in Charleston until its closing and then with the Sutherland Oil Company and Delta Growers Association until his retirement in February 2007.

He was a U.S. Army veteran of the Vietnam War and was a member of the American Legion.

He and Debra Grissom were married Sept. 28, 1970.

Survivors include his wife; a daughter, Katy Layton of Charleston; three sisters, Cheryl Reinbott of Scott City, Joyce Russell of Wyatt, Mo., Melissa Triplett of Anniston; and two grandsons.

He was preceded in death by two sisters.

Visitation will be from 5 to 8 p.m. today at McMikle Funeral Home in Charleston.

The funeral will be at 11 a.m. Wednesday at the funeral home, with the Rev. David Dowdy officiating. Burial will be in Oak Grove Cemetery near Charleston with military rites provided by Missouri Military Honors Program.
